Object Description
A Roman terracotta oil lamp featuring a circular concave discuss enriched with the portrait of the goddess Luna. She is depicted facing forward with her hair elegantly styled in a bun. Underneath her bust is a crescent moon slightly encompassing the portrait. A filling hole is visible below the moon. Three concentric grooves frame the imagery. The oil lamp displays a voluted angular-tipped nozzle and a flat base with one incised band.
Date: Circa 1st-2nd century AD
